Creamy Macaroni and Cheese


Ingredients
2 cups uncooked elbow macaroni (an 8-ounce box isn't quite 2 cups)
4 tablespoons (1/2 stuck) butter, cut into pieces
2 1/2 cups (about 10 ounces) grated sharp Cheddar cheese
3 eggs, beaten
1/2 cup sour cream
1 (10 3/4-ounce) can condensed Cheddar cheese soup
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up whole milk
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
Directions
Boil the macaroni in a 2 quart saucepan in plenty of water until tender, about 7 minutes. Drain. In a medium saucepan, mix butter and cheese. Stir until the cheese melts. In a slow cooker, combine cheese/butter mixture and add the eggs, sour cream, soup, salt, milk, mustard and pepper and stir well. Then add drained macaroni and stir again. Set the slow cooker on low setting and cook for 3 hours, stirring occasionally.

BROWN BEANS SOUP (OWOSEMI)

Owosemi as is widely known in the South Western part of Nigeria is a beautiful deviation from the every day soup.

It is more popular because unlike other soups that you can use to transport your Eba, Pounded yam or Semo food home, Owosemi can be used for all and sundry; from swallows to boiled yam, rice or even boiled plantains.

Recipe 11

Serves 8

3 Lbs. Dry Beans coress 1 1/2 kg
or periwinkle
1/2 Lb. Shelled Beans 250 g
8 pts. Water 4 Ltr.
1 pt. Oil 1/2 ltr.
1/4 tsp. egidije
1 whole green Plantain
5 oz. Dry Crayfish 125 g
2 Lbs. Dry fish (smoked) 1 kg
1 Lbs. Dry Bush Meat 1/2 kg
1/4 tsp. Dry pepper
Owomumu (salt)
Epo firifiri

- Wash dry beans. Cook in cold water for 1 hr. with the beans.
- Add the well cleaned bush meat, smoked fish and plantain.
- Cook for another 15 mins.
- Remove the seed and add the crushed skin of the egidije.
- Add the crayfish.
- Remove plantain from beans. Mash.
- Add the salt (owomumu; please note that any other one will turn the soup watery) and epo firifiri.
- Simmer for another 20 mins. stirring occasionally.
- Serve hot with starch, boiled yam or boiled plantain.
